71 Highfield Gardens, London, Barnet, Greater London Authority, NW11 9HA has an Energy Performance Certificate (EPC) rating of B, based on the latest assessment carried out on 13 Mar 2014.

This property uses a gas boiler with underfloor heating as its main heating source. It is connected to mains gas. Hot water is provided from main heating system. The windows are high performance glazing.

The previous EPC assessment was conducted on 1 Mar 2010, when the property was rated F. Since then, the rating has improved to B, with the energy efficiency score increasing by 150%.

Since the previous assessment, several changes were observed:

  • The heating system changed from boiler and radiators, mains gas to boiler & underfloor, mains gas, with no change in energy efficiency (good).
  • The hot water system was changed from from main system, no cylinder thermostat to from main system, with its energy efficiency improving from average to good.
  • The roof construction or insulation changed from pitched, no insulation (assumed) to average thermal transmittance 0.17 w/m-¦k, improving energy efficiency from very poor to good.
  • The wall construction or insulation changed from cavity wall, as built, no insulation (assumed) to average thermal transmittance 0.22 w/m-¦k, improving energy efficiency from poor to very good.
  • The windows were upgraded from single glazed to high performance glazing.
  • The lighting was updated from no low energy lighting to low energy lighting in all fixed outlets, with efficiency improving from very poor to very good.
